The Liturgy<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: large;\">&n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p;The Liturgy of Ascension had been describing the Catholic Church that Christ had just established; what was the plan of salvation it would be accomplishing, who would be its teachers, where would its classroom be and what kind of pupils it will have. The Sunday and weekdays had been describing who would be its teachers, Jesus Christ first and foremost and the apostles as His successors.&nbsp;<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: large;\">&n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p;The Liturgy today&nbsp;emphasised its teacher again, Jesus Christ, the eternal High Priest. As High Priest of the Catholic Church, Christ had three functions according to St. Thomas of Aquinas. First, He would take away the sins of the people. Secondly, He would give them the gift of Faith. And&nbsp;thirdly, He would give them the virtue of Charity.&nbsp;<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: large;\">&n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; Thus the successors of Christ, the Pope, Bishop and priest should do the same for the Church to be worthy priests of the &nbsp;Church of Christ. Thus, the Pope, bishop and priest should teach the people how to acquire the virtue of Penance for the forgiveness of their past sins. This consist in living a life of Prayer, Penance and Good works as described by St. Augustine. Acquiring the virtue of Penance is not the same as the sacrament of Penance. The virtue of Penance that should accompany the sacrament is what forgives sins.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: large;\">&n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p;Secondly, the Pope, bishops and priests should teach the people, what Christ commanded the apostles to do, to teach them all the commands of Christ as enumerated in the New Testament and how to obey them, as written down by the Fathers of the Church, that the people may acquire the virtue of Faith.&nbsp;<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: large;\">&n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p;Thirdly, the Pope, bishops and priests should teach the people how to acquire Charity, first, by receiving the first breath of Christ, to empower them to love their neighbour and secondly, &nbsp;to receive the Holy Spirit to empower them to love God above all things.&nbsp;<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: large;\">2.
